Output 08246a5d4dcbb59eb03e22eea89a108a1837d270f57baf2e5f4a7da965d5e546:0

value
665972826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71bd4a15a7e23c999e3ea54f4d72114d2e7f7f9f OP_EQUAL
address
3C4R3H64fRyEZvf4DoYKSZNhbmrffzwF27
transaction
08246a5d4dcbb59eb03e22eea89a108a1837d270f57baf2e5f4a7da965d5e546
spent
true